Straus Institute brings conflict resolution training for law enforcement to Los Angeles Police Department

November 1, 2016 -- On October 20, Professors Blondell and Robinson delivered a Conflict Resolution Training for over two hundred employees of the Los Angeles Police Department's Office of Constitutional Policing & Policy. Straus was invited by the Director of the Office, Arif Alikhan, one of many dispute resolution leaders in the Department. As a part of our on-going partnership with the Department, Straus offered scholarships to LAPD Officers in the Master of Dispute Resolution Program. The fall semester brought us six outstanding LAPD (officers, detectives and sergeants); we will admit another group this spring. LAPD, thank you for your service!
